Output 953f4c61d451faeac86319cef240e67ddd44a1ae50b51e7683d126f1139aa1ce:2

value
105782562
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2e7a2b720224ba1d15a532599e5d676b5332d2a OP_EQUAL
address
3KTaW5mMP3AQ7Ge6C32xwsJjTRhhMVB6d8
transaction
953f4c61d451faeac86319cef240e67ddd44a1ae50b51e7683d126f1139aa1ce
spent
true